Mission

What the business is for, and who it serves.

TurnTwo is consulting-first. The practice is Jay's web development and technology modernization work; everything else exists to feed it. The free and low-cost tools, the skill packs, the membership — they're lead generation and credibility, not the business model. The business model is scoped client builds delivered on a shared backbone that makes them fast.

The positioning

The current shift is the outcomes pivot: stop reading as a directory of gadgets, start selling outcomes. The market gap Jay is aiming at — AI consulting splits into strategists who won't build and automation shops that won't think, and almost nobody publishes a price or shows a clickable receipt. TurnTwo does the opposite: publish the price, show the receipt, tell the truth about what a client actually needs (including when the honest answer is "you don't need a rebuild").

The hard constraint

Every offering must be deliverable async — intake, build, collect, with no live customer hand-holding. That filter rules out retainers, fractional-CAIO arrangements, and live walkthroughs, and it shapes every product decision.

Who it serves

Three public audiences, plus direct consulting clients:

  • Government and IT professionals — Jay's credibility edge. Tools for gov IT (GCC eligibility, ATO readiness, federal resumes, SOWs, M365 roadmaps).
  • Entrepreneurs and operators — people who need a business case, an SOP, a proposal, a website, done fast.
  • Developers — people who want to cut token cost and ship better prompts (see Workbench).

The diagnostic funnel

Lens is how a prospect goes from "something's off" to a scoped engagement: a free website audit on top, a paid Business Modernization Assessment underneath, and a discovery tool that interviews them before a quote. The bolt-on front door does the same for owners of existing sites.
